Historical Events on September 25

History has been made on your birthday. The following are important historical events that occurred on September 25th.

YearEvent
1963Lord Denning releases the UK government's official report on the Profumo affair.
1964The Mozambican War of Independence against Portugal begins.
1969The charter establishing the Organisation of Islamic Cooperation is signed.
1974Dr. Frank Jobe performs first ulnar collateral ligament replacement surgery (better known as Tommy John surgery) on baseball player Tommy John.
1977About 4,200 people take part in the first running of the Chicago Marathon.
1978PSA Flight 182, a Boeing 727, collides in mid-air with a Cessna 172 and crashes in San Diego, killing all 135 aboard Flight 182, both occupants of the Cessna, as well as seven people on the ground.
1981Belize joins the United Nations.
1983Thirty-eight IRA prisoners, armed with six handguns, hijack a prison meals lorry and smash their way out of the Maze Prison.
1987Fijian Governor-General Penaia Ganilau is overthrown in a coup d'état led by Lieutenant colonel Sitiveni Rabuka.[citation needed]
1992NASA launches the Mars Observer. Eleven months later, the probe would fail while preparing for orbital insertion.

Popular Baby Name on September 25, 1941

In 1941, there were many popular baby names. For baby boys, James is the most used. A total of 66,743 baby boys were named James in 1941. The rest were named Robert, John, William and Richard. While the popular baby girl name in 1941 was Mary. There were 58,041 baby girls named Mary that year. While the rest were named Barbara, Patricia, Carol and Linda. These statistics are obtained from ssa.gov which compiles popular baby names of the last century in United States.
